Make sure you get a proper lowering kit with matched shocks/springs. You may not be able to get springs that go that low on their own using the standard shocks. Coilovers are the ones for going low I believe. I have heard of people cutting their springs to go lower, but this will fail an MOT as when the car is jacked up on the ramps, the springs fall out of the shock cups! oooops. Rember - Don't bodge it, do it properly.
